What looked like a pretty good matchup on paper turned into a blowout by the second quarter. As the Redskins simply dominated the Bills on both sides of the ball on the line of scrimmage. The Bills never getting a running game going and as a result not being able to protect. QB Jim Kelly who was hit and knocked down throughout the game. And the Bills not being able to stop the Redskins running game. Giving QB Mark Rypien plenty of time to hit those big deep passes down the field with Bills defense. Having to worry so much about the Redskins running game.
